This commit include the following changes:
- SourceOverrides is now a class
- it simplifies the usage for the Transform class, since now the
replacements can be applied directly to the file overrides with
SourceOverrides::applyReplacements().
- it contains a method applyRewrites() which was previously named
collectResults() in Transform.cpp. The method has been "optimized"
a bit to re-use the allocated buffer (std::string::clear() is called).
- since the class has some logic it's now unit tested
- Now FileOverrides is a class (not a std::map typedef) and store pointers
to the SourceOverrides. The reason is that the SourceOverrides can't be
copied anymore (which was already something to avoid since it's can be a
quite large object).
